What to Consider When Choosing a Robot Vacuum:
Choosing the best robot vacuum includes more than just selecting the flashiest design. Thoroughly think about the following aspects to guarantee you choose a gadget that genuinely satisfies your needs and supplies value:
- Budget: Robot vacuums range in cost from under ₤ 200 to over ₤ 1000. Identify your budget upfront to limit your alternatives. Keep in mind that greater price points often correlate with more advanced functions like smarter navigation, more powerful suction, and self-emptying capabilities.
- Floor Types: Consider the dominant floor key ins your home. Houses with mainly tough floorings may gain from models with mopping functions, while homes with thick carpets require strong suction power and brush roll styles crafted for carpet cleaning. Some models are versatile and perform well on both tough floorings and carpets.
- Pet Ownership: Pet hair is a common cleaning difficulty. If you have family pets, try to find robot vacuums particularly designed to take on pet hair. These often include tangle-free brush rolls, robust suction, and efficient purification systems to catch irritants.
-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or those with numerous levels might demand robot vacuums with longer battery life and smart mapping functions to guarantee complete cleaning coverage. Residences with complicated designs and many obstacles will take advantage of advanced navigation systems.
- Smart Features and Connectivity: Do you want app control, scheduling, virtual walls, or voice assistant integration? Smart includes improve benefit and customisation but typically come at a higher price.
- Navigation and Mapping:
- Random Bounce: Basic designs often use random bounce navigation, which is less effective but can still clean successfully in smaller spaces.
- Methodical Navigation (LiDAR or Camera-based): More advanced designs utilize L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or camera-based systems to map your home and browse systematically. This results in more efficient cleaning, room-by-room cleaning, and the ability to set virtual boundaries.
- Suction Power: Measured in Pascals (Pa), suction power identifies how efficiently a robot vacuum gets dirt and debris. Greater suction is usually much better, particularly for carpets and pet hair.
- Battery Life and Charging: Battery life determines the length of time the robot vacuum can run on a single charge. Think about the size of your home and select a design with sufficient battery life to clean it efficiently. automatic vacuum cleaner recharging is a basic feature, where the robot returns to its dock when the battery is low.
- Self-Emptying Feature: Some premium designs feature self-emptying bases. These bases automatically draw the dust and particles from the robot's dustbin into a bigger, disposable bag, substantially minimizing the frequency of manual dustbin clearing and boosting benefit.
- Noise Level: Robot vacuums vary in sound output. If sound sensitivity is a concern, search for designs advertised as quiet operating.

Tips for Getting the Most Out of Your Robot Vacuum:
To guarantee your robot vacuum runs successfully and effectively for many years to come, consider these valuable suggestions:
-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ot vacuum, declutter your floorings by getting rid of loose cables, little toys, and other challenges that might hinder its navigation or get tangled in the brushes.
- Routine Maintenance: Empty the dustbin regularly (or less regularly with self-emptying models), clean the brushes and filters as advised by the manufacturer, and look for any obstructions or use and tear.
- Set Up Cleaning Sessions: Utilize the scheduling feature to set your robot vacuum to tidy instantly at hassle-free times, such as when you are at work or asleep.
- Usage Virtual Boundaries: If your robot vacuum has virtual wall or zoned cleaning functions, utilize them to avoid the robot from going into specific areas or to target cleaning to certain spaces.
- Display Performance: Occasionally observe your robot vacuum in action to guarantee it is cleaning effectively and browsing properly. Address any concerns quickly.
- Keep Software Updated: If your robot vacuum has app connectivity, guarantee you keep the firmware and app upgraded to benefit from the current functions and efficiency enhancements.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s):
- Q: Are robot vacuums worth the investment?
- A: For hectic people and those seeking to reduce their cleaning work, robot vacuums can be a beneficial financial investment. They automate a tedious task and can preserve a regularly cleaner home.
- Q: Can robot Vacuums Uk vacuums change traditional vacuums totally?
- A: Robot vacuums are exceptional for routine maintenance cleaning but may not entirely replace traditional vacuums for deep cleaning jobs, corner cleaning, or cleaning upholstery and stairs. Lots of users find they supplement their robot vacuum with a traditional vacuum for more intensive cleaning.
- Q: How typically should I run my robot vacuum?
- A: Daily cleaning is ideal for preserving a regularly tidy home, particularly in homes with family pets or kids. However, you can change the frequency based upon your needs and home traffic.
- Q: Do robot vacuums work on carpets and rugs?
- A: Yes, numerous robot vacuums are designed to work on both difficult floorings and carpets. Look for designs with strong suction and brush rolls designed for carpet cleaning efficiency.
- Q: How long do robot vacuums normally last?
- A: With appropriate maintenance, a great quality robot vacuum can last for numerous years, usually 3-5 years or longer depending upon use and brand name.
- Q: Are robot vacuums loud?
- A: Robot vacuums generally produce less noise than standard vacuums, however noise levels differ between designs. Some designs are specifically created for quieter operation.
- Q: What is the difference in between LiDAR and camera-based navigation?
- A: L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) utilizes lasers to develop a detailed map of your home, providing exact navigation and effective cleaning paths. Camera-based systems use visual details to browse. LiDAR is typically thought about more precise and reliable in low-light conditions.
